Definitions of regimentation word

  • noun regimentation the act of regimenting or the state of being regimented. 1
  • noun regimentation the strict discipline and enforced uniformity characteristic of military groups or totalitarian systems. 1
  • noun regimentation strict regularity 1
  • uncountable noun regimentation Regimentation is very strict control over the way a group of people behave or the way something is done. 0

Origin of regimentation

First appearance:

before 1875
One of the 25% newest English words
First recorded in 1875-85; regiment + -ation
